Colleges

Massey is organised into five colleges. The Massey Business School, the College of Creative Arts, the College of Health, the College of Humanities and Social Sciences, and the College of Sciences.

Exams

Our students generally sit exams during June (Semester One), November (Semester Two) and February (Summer School). We provide a range of information about exams to assist students to prepare for their exams. We also publish exam results and grades online as they become available.

Student learning resources

We provide academic learning support services to help students to succeed in their university study. Student learning services are available online and at all three campuses. Consultations are confidential and open to all Massey students from first year to PhD students.
